DrawOrder

Works with Bricscad (Windows) Classic, Pro and Platinum, Bricscad (Linux) Classic and Pro

Changes the display order of overlapping entities.

: draworder

Prompts you in the command bar:

Select entities to change draw order: (Choose one or more entities)

Change draw order: Above/Under/Clear/Front/<Back>: (Enter an option.)

Command Options

Option

Description

Select Entities to Change Draw Order

Selects one or more entities; this command is meant to work with overlapping objects.

Above

Moves the entities above other entities, but not necessarily to the top (front) of display order.

Under

Moves the entities below other entities, but not necessarily to the bottom (back) of display order.

Clear

Clears assigned display orders; entities are displayed as they were originally created.

The last created entity is displayed on top of one created earlier.

Front

Moves the entities' display order above all other entities.

Back

Moves the entities' display order below all other entities.
